firefighters intervene to save seven calves that fell into a manure pit

Seven calves fell into a slurry pit of a farm, this Friday at the end of the day, in Loireauxence (Loire-Atlantique). Faced with the large volume of this pit, the rescuers pulled out all the stops to help these animals. A perilous operation, where the roof of the shed had to be unbolted where the animals were kept.

The seven calves fell into a manure pit, the rescuers were forced to pump out part of this pit for the rescue.

Then, the twenty firefighters on site deployed a crane outside. Then, with the support of the farmers, the rescuers began their evacuation operation. One by one the calves were placed in a net to be taken out of the building by air. It was also necessary to pump out part of the slurry pit to facilitate the rescue work. The other 200 calves in the shed have been moved to safety.
